      This collection features the writings of Brother George Oliver, drawn from a variety of 19th-century Masonic journals. It offers insights into Masonic philosophy, practices, and historical context, showcasing Oliver's contributions to the understanding of Freemasonry during that era. Readers will find a blend of reflections, interpretations, and discussions that illuminate the principles and values of the Masonic tradition.

      Exploring the notion that every aspect of life harbors a unique ideal, these essays delve into the pursuit of a better existence. They emphasize the unfinished nature of the universe and our role as collaborators in its improvement across various fields, including business, politics, and religion. The author argues that true progress requires a commitment not only to current realities but also to potential futures. Diverse topics are woven together by the overarching theme of striving for an eternal progression toward what has yet to be achieved.

      Intended to provoke thoughtful reflection, the essays in this collection offer intense and engaging writing. The selections prioritize the topics over the authors' political, social, or religious backgrounds, ensuring a focus on the content itself. Despite some authors having controversial histories, the essays remain intellectually stimulating. Originally published in 1903, the collection covers a variety of themes, inviting readers to explore diverse perspectives and ideas.
